About Alexander B. Sideridis
Alexander B. Sideridis is a scholar working on Numerical Analysis, Information Systems and Media Technology, having authored 58 papers that have together received 798 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include E-Government and Public Services (5 papers), ICT Impact and Policies (4 papers) and Data Management and Algorithms (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Numerical Analysis (75 citations), Media Technology (63 citations) and Food Science (120 citations). Alexander B. Sideridis has collaborated with scholars based in Greece and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include C.P. Yialouris, Charalampos Z. Patrikakis, Eftychia Xylouri, Athanasios Voulodimos, Vasileios Ntafis, H.C. Passam, T. E. Simos, Nikos A. Lorentzos, Sotiris Karetsos and N. Papamichael. Their work appears in journals such as Expert Systems with Applications, Computer Methods in Applied Mechanics and Engineering and Information & Management.
